Re: 400/406 Builds

With flat top pistons and a small chamber head such as the 'camel humps' I believe you are going to be closer to 11-1. This is too high to run pump gas especially with a mild cam and the less efficient combustion chamber of those heads. With those pistons you will need a head with a combustion chamber of around 72-76cc. You will also want to choose a cam with a intake valve closing point that will help create a streetable dynamic compression.

Sorry to say but those AFR 227 heads are way too big for street use. The low and mid range power is going to suffer. I would recommend a head with a intake size of 190-195cc. Depending on what you want a 180cc head would likely be just fine.

Changing the Vic Jr for a Performer RPM air gap as well as upgrading to a roller cam is a good decision.
